Excalibur is Restaffine's ika-metal squid series, built on the full-length boron blank for the squid-metal method. Ika-metal fishes a metal squid jig over depth, often from a boat, and demands a rod with a sensitive tip to register a squid's light take on the metal while keeping enough backbone to work the jig and lift the catch. The boron blank gives Excalibur its load behavior for that balance of feel and strength. Rods are made to order, with guide options in titanium-frame SiC or stainless. The boron blank is chosen here to register a squid's light take on the metal while keeping the backbone to work a deep jig and lift the catch, the balance ika-metal asks of a rod. Excalibur is the second of Restaffine's two squid series, covering the ika-metal method while DeepJerkee handles boat eging with egi jigs, so between them the brand covers both main boat squid styles for aori squid and squid-metal work.

63αTi Casting · 6'3"

Short baitcasting ika-metal rod with a sensitive titanium tip section, matched to a 30号 sinker.

65α Bait Casting · 6'5"

Baitcasting version of the 65α boat squid rod, the lightest standard Excalibur at 120 g.

65α Spinning Spinning · 6'5"

Spinning version of the 65α boat squid rod, a touch shorter and lighter at 130 g.

65αTi Spinning · 6'5"

Spinning omorig rod with a titanium tip for subtle squid bites, matched to a 30号 sinker.

68-1.5 Spinning · 6'8"

Spinning boat ika-metal boron rod for spear and common squid, matched to a 30号 sinker.
